Forestry seedling breeding device
Technical Field
The utility model relates to a forestry field especially relates to a forestry seedling culture device.
Background
In the cultivation of forestry seedling, generally place the seedling and cultivate in seedling raising box with the seedling, seedling raising box is generally darker in order to guarantee the growth of seedling root, and taking out of seedling is very inconvenient when transplanting of seedling on darker soil horizon.

Detailed Description
The invention is explained in more detail below with reference to the figures and examples:
a seedling cultivating device for forestry comprises a cultivating box 01, air holes 03, a supporting frame plate 04, supporting legs 05, positioning rods 06, partition boards 09 and supporting rods 12, wherein the supporting frame plate 04 is connected with the supporting legs 05 at the lower part, four supporting legs 05 are distributed at four corners of the lower part of the supporting frame plate 04, the supporting frame plate 04 is connected with the supporting legs 05 at the lower part, the supporting frame plate 04 and the supporting legs 05 form a bracket, the lower surface of the cultivating box 01 is connected with the supporting frame plate 04, the bracket supports the cultivating box 01, the supporting frame plate 04 is provided with a plurality of positioning rod lower grooves 07, the lower parts of the positioning rods 06 are matched with the positioning rod lower grooves 07, the lower parts of the positioning rods 06 are inserted into the positioning rod lower grooves 07, the bottom of the cultivating box 01 is provided with a plurality of positioning rod upper grooves 08, the upper parts of the positioning rods 06 are matched with the positioning rod upper grooves 08, the upper parts of the, insert locating lever upper groove 08 on locating lever 06 upper portion, through locating lever 06 to artificial containers 01 transverse positioning, avoid artificial containers 01 drunkenness on support frame board 04 under the collision of external force, artificial containers 01 has artificial containers 02, artificial containers 02 bottom has a plurality of bleeder vents 03, artificial containers 02 bottom has baffle hole 10, baffle 09 suits with baffle hole 10, baffle 09 passes baffle hole 10, baffle hole 10 fixes a position baffle 09, separate into a plurality of solitary regions through a plurality of baffle 09 with artificial containers 02 inside and cultivate the seedling, baffle 09 is in the coplanar with artificial containers 01 upper surface.
The lower part of the clapboard 09 is provided with a clapboard lower plate 11, the upper surface of the clapboard lower plate 11 is connected with a cultivating box 01, a supporting frame plate 04 is provided with a supporting rod hole 13, a supporting rod 12 is matched with the supporting rod hole 13, the supporting rod 12 passes through the supporting rod hole 13, the upper part of the supporting rod 12 is connected with the clapboard lower plate 11, the supporting rod 12 supports the clapboard 09 to prevent the clapboard 09 from sliding down through the clapboard hole 10, the supporting rod 12 is provided with a supporting rod side plate 14, the side surface of the supporting rod side plate 14 is connected with the supporting frame plate 04, the supporting rod side plate 14 is provided with a handle 15, the supporting rods 12 are symmetrically arranged at the front side and the rear side of the clapboard lower plate 11, the clapboards 09 are uniformly distributed in the cultivating groove 02, the clapboard 09 is arranged into a component capable of moving up and down, soil is arranged in the cultivating groove 02 when a seedling is cultivated, the side surface of the, and then soil is poured into the container, and when the seedlings are transplanted and taken out, the partition plate 09 is detached, so that the roots of the whole seedlings can be taken out conveniently.
